STRAWBERRY REFRIGERATOR CAKE



Strawberry Refrigerator Cake image

Delicious cool summer dessert. Just as good in the winter. Allow it to chill at least 4 hours before serving.

Provided by Deborah Westbrook

Categories     Desserts     Fruit Dessert Recipes     Strawberry Dessert Recipes

Time 5h20m

Yield 12

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 box strawberry cake mix
1 ⅓ cups water
3 eggs
⅓ cup vegetable oil
2 (10 ounce) packages frozen strawberries
1 (3.5 ounce) package instant vanilla pudding mix
1 cup milk
2 cups frozen whipped topping, thawed
1 pint fresh strawberries

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Grease and flour a 9x13-inch baking dish.
  • Prepare cake mix as directed on package. Pour batter into prepared pan and bake until a tester inserted in the center comes out clean, about 30 minutes. Allow cake to cool on wire rack.
  • Poke holes on top of cake. Puree thawed strawberries with juice in a blender or food processor and spoon over top of baked cake.
  • To Make Topping: Prepare pudding mix as directed on package using one cup of milk. Fold whipped topping into pudding mixture and spread over cake. Arrange strawberries on top of cake, if desired.
  • Refrigerate cake for at least 4 hours before serving.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 372.5 calories, Carbohydrate 60.7 g, Cholesterol 42.5 mg, Fat 13.9 g, Fiber 1.5 g, Protein 3.7 g, SaturatedFat 5.8 g, Sodium 414.4 mg, Sugar 42.7 g

STRAWBERRY POKE REFRIGERATOR CAKE



Strawberry Poke Refrigerator Cake image

Use only a very large-holed straw or the long handle of a wooden spoon to make the holes in the top of the cake or the strawberry puree will not penatrate, the holes must be at least 3/4-inch large for this. Plan well in advance the baked cake must be room temperature before topping with the puree, then there are two 2-hour chilling times after, to save time you can bake the cake a day ahead, cool then cover with plastic wrap, prep time includes chilling times. Do not make the mistake of making this into a layer cake the topping will not hold onto the sides of the cake ;-) Yellow or lemon flavor cake mix works well for this or you can use Betty Crocker Super Moist Strawberry Cake Mix. This cake is nothing short of absolutely *FANTASTIC*

Provided by Kittencalrecipezazz

Categories     Dessert

Time 50m

Yield 12-16 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 (18 1/4 ounce) package white cake mix (or use yellow cake mix)
3 egg whites (or as called for by your cake mix) or 3 eggs (or as called for by your cake mix)
1/3 cup oil (or as called for by your cake mix)
1 1/3 cups water (or as called for by your cake mix)
2 (10 ounce) packages frozen strawberries, completely thawed (do not drain the juice)
1 (3 1/2 ounce) package vanilla pudding mix (or cream cheese pudding mix)
1 cup half-and-half cream or 1 cup use 18% table cream
1/2 tablespoon cornstarch
1 (8 ounce) container cool whip frozen whipped topping, thawed
fresh sliced strawberry

Steps:

  • Prepare the cake as directed on the package and bake in a 13 x 9-inch baking pan; cool to room temperature.
  • Using a straw poke holes all over the top of the cake almost to the bottom about 1-inch apart (make large enough and deep holes, the more holes the better!).
  • In a processor or blender puree the thawed strawberries until smooth, then slowly drizzle over the top of the cake paying more attention to the holes.
  • Refrigerate for 2 hours.
  • For the topping; prepare the pudding mix using 1 cup only of half and half cream and add in the 1/2 tablespoon cornstarch to the pudding mixture while mixing; beat until smooth and thickened.
  • Fold in the thawed Cool Whip until combined.
  • Spread over the top of the cake (cake must be completely cold before topping).
  • Arrange the sliced strawberries on top in a decorative pattern.
  • Refrigerate for 2 or more hours before serving.
